'use strict' const h2url = require('h2url') const t = require('node:test') const assert = require('node:assert') const Fastify = require('fastify') const { request, Agent } = require('undici') const From = require('..') const fs = require('node:fs') const path = require('node:path') const certs = { allowHTTP1: true, // fallback support for HTTP1 key: fs.readFileSync(path.join(__dirname, 'fixtures', 'fastify.key')), cert: fs.readFileSync(path.join(__dirname, 'fixtures', 'fastify.cert')) } const instance = Fastify({ http2: true, https: certs }) const target = Fastify({ https: certs }) target.get('/', (_request, reply) => { assert.ok('request proxied') reply.code(404).header('x-my-header', 'hello!').send({ hello: 'world' }) }) instance.get('/', (_request, reply) => { reply.from() }) async function run (t) { await target.listen({ port: 0 }) instance.register(From, { base: `https://localhost:${target.server.address().port}`, rejectUnauthorized: false }) await instance.listen({ port: 0 }) await t.test('http2 -> https', async (t) => { t.plan(4) const { headers, body } = await h2url.concat({ url: `https://localhost:${instance.server.address().port}` }) t.assert.strictEqual(headers[':status'], 404) t.assert.strictEqual(headers['x-my-header'], 'hello!') t.assert.match(headers['content-type'], /application\/json/) t.assert.deepStrictEqual(JSON.parse(body), { hello: 'world' }) }) await t.test('https -> https', async (t) => { t.plan(4) const result = await request(`https://localhost:${instance.server.address().port}`, { dispatcher: new Agent({ connect: { rejectUnauthorized: false } }) }) t.assert.strictEqual(result.statusCode, 404) t.assert.strictEqual(result.headers['x-my-header'], 'hello!') t.assert.match(result.headers['content-type'], /application\/json/) t.assert.deepStrictEqual(await result.body.json(), { hello: 'world' }) }) } t.test('http2 -> https', async (t) => { t.plan(2) t.after(() => instance.close()) t.after(() => target.close()) await run(t) })
